Course details
Navigation and Control Systems: This unit covers the fundamental principles of navigation and control systems used in autonomous maritime vehicles, including sensor fusion, mapping, and decision-making algorithms. •

Sensor Suites and Data Fusion: This unit explores the various sensor suites used in autonomous maritime vehicles, including sonar, radar, lidar, and cameras, and how they are fused to provide a comprehensive understanding of the environment. •

Career path
| **Career Role: Autonomous Maritime Systems Engineer** | Design, develop, and integrate autonomous systems for maritime applications, ensuring safety, efficiency, and environmental sustainability. |
|---|---|
| **Career Role: Marine Robotics Engineer** | Develop and operate autonomous underwater vehicles (AUVs) and surface vehicles (SUVs) for various marine applications, including surveying, inspection, and research. |
| **Career Role: Autonomous Maritime Systems Analyst** | Analyze and optimize autonomous maritime systems for improved performance, safety, and environmental impact, working closely with engineers and stakeholders. |
| **Career Role: Marine AI/Machine Learning Engineer** | Develop and deploy artificial intelligence (AI) and machine learning (ML) models for autonomous maritime applications, such as predictive maintenance and anomaly detection. |
